How Antimicrobial Treatment Services Really Work
A proper antimicrobial treatment process is crucial for effectively eliminating and preventing the regrowth of harmful microorganisms. Skipping steps or using the wrong products can lead to recurring issues and even more extensive damage down the line. Our crews follow a rigorous, IICRC-certified protocol to ensure your home is treated correctly. We focus on containment, thorough cleaning, and preventative measures, all documented for your records and insurance needs.
1. Initial Inspection and Containment
Our first step involves a detailed inspection to assess the extent of microbial growth. We’ll identify the source of moisture, if applicable, and set up containment barriers to prevent spores from spreading. This usually takes 1-2 hours, depending on the affected area’s size.
2. Cleaning and Removal
Using EPA-approved antimicrobial solutions and specialized cleaning tools, we carefully remove all visible microbial growth. This stage requires precision and the right protective gear. Depending on the severity, this can take anywhere from a few hours to a couple of days.
3. Drying and Dehumidification
Once cleaned, we use indust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ers to thoroughly dry out the affected materials and surrounding areas. Proper drying is essential to prevent future growth. This process can take 1-3 days, often running 24/7.
4. Air Filtration and Treatment
We employ HEPA air scrubbers to capture airborne spores and further purify the air. In some cases, we may use fogging equipment to apply antimicrobial treatments to hard-to-reach areas and neutralize remaining airborne contaminants. This typically lasts for 24-72 hours.
5. Final Inspection and Prevention
Our team conducts a final walkthrough to ensure all treatment goals have been met and discuss any necessary preventative measures with you. We’ll provide documentation for your records and insurance claims. This final step usually takes about an hour.

Warning Signs You Need Antimicrobial Treatment Services
Catching microbial growth early is vital for your health and your wallet. Ignoring these signs can lead to more extensive damage, higher repair costs, and potential health issues for your family. Our team helps you identify and address these problems quickly.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ent damp, earthy smell, especially after rain or if you’ve had any past water intrusion, is a strong indicator of hidden microbial growth. This odor often lingers even after cleaning surfaces.
Visible Splotches or Discoloration
Any dark spots, fuzzy patches, or unusual discoloration on walls, ceilings, or other surfaces could be a sign of microbial colonies. They can appear in various colors like green, black, white, or brown.
Past Water Damage or Leaks
If your property has experienced any water damage, like from a leaky pipe, roof leak, or flooding, even if it seemed to dry out, there’s a high risk of microbial growth developing in hidden cavities. Proactive treatment is often recommended.
Increased Allergy or Respiratory Symptoms
Sudden or worsening allergy symptoms, persistent coughing, sneezing, or breathing difficulties among household members can sometimes be linked to poor indoor air quality caused by microbial growth. This is a serious health concern.
Condensation on Windows or Pipes
Excessive condensation can indicate high indoor humidity levels, which create ideal conditions for microbial growth. This moisture can soak into building materials, feeding unseen colonies.
Peeling Paint or Warped Materials
Changes in the appearance of building materials, such as peeling paint, bubbling wallpaper, or warped wood, can be a sign that moisture is present and potentially causing damage behind the surface. This often means microbial activity is likely occurring.
Antimicrobial Treatment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, isolated spots on non-porous surfaces (e.g., tile) | Yes, with caution | Maybe | For minor issues, careful cleaning might suffice, but professionals ensure thorough eradication. |
| Musty odors without visible growth | No | Yes | Odors indicate hidden growth, which requires specialized detection and treatment. |
| Growth on porous materials (e.g., drywall, wood, carpet) | No | Yes | These materials absorb moisture and growth, making DIY removal ineffective and potentially spreading spores. |
| Previous water damage in walls or attics | No | Yes | Hidden moisture and growth behind surfaces need professional assessment and treatment. |
| Health concerns or compromised immune systems in household | No | Yes | Protecting vulnerable individuals requires the highest level of certainty and effectiveness. |
| Large affected areas (more than 10 sq ft) | No | Yes | Extensive growth requires containment and specialized equipment professionals provide. |

Common Questions About Antimicrobial Treatment Services
What’s the difference between mold and other microbial growth?
Microbial growth is a broad term that includes mold, mildew, bacteria, and other microorganisms. While often used interchangeably with mold, other microbes can also pose health risks and damage materials. Will my homeowner’s insurance cover antimicrobial treatment?
Coverage often depends on the cause of the microbial growth. If it resulted from a sudden, accidental event like a burst pipe, insurance may cover it. If it’s due to long-term neglect or poor maintenance, it might not be covered. How can I prevent microbial growth after treatment?
The best prevention is controlling moisture. This means fixing any leaks promptly, ensuring good ventilation in bathrooms and kitchens, using dehumidifiers in humid areas, and cleaning up spills quickly. What health risks are associated with microbial growth in my home?
Exposure to microbial growth can trigger a range of health issues, including allergic reactions, asthma attacks, respiratory infections, and other symptoms like coughing, sneezing, and skin irritation. Those with pre-existing conditions or compromised immune systems are particularly vulnerable. Addressing it promptly is crucial for protecting your family’s well-being.
